Избранное трейдера will
Последовательность чисел Фибоначчи: 1, 1, 2, 3, 5, 8, 13, 21, 34, 55, 89 и так далее до бесконечности. В книге Фроста и Пректера «Волновой принцип Эллиотта: ключ к поведению рынка» добавлено: «После первых нескольких чисел в последовательности отношение любого числа к следующему большему числу составляет приблизительно 0,618 к 1, а к следующему меньшему числу — приблизительно 1,618 к 1». Существуют и другие ключевые соотношения Фибоначчи, но .618 (1,618) настолько особенное, что его называют Золотым сечением. Это соотношение можно найти во всей природе, а также в графических моделях финансовых рынков. Итак, аналитики Elliott Wave International используют в своей работе соотношения Фибоначчи. В качестве примера можно привести следующую диаграмму и комментарии из нашего Global Market Perspective за август 2024 года:
Первое, что Вы увидите, открыв OsEngine, обозреватель решения с папками справа. Главное в этот момент не испугаться.
В этих папках хранится весь проект, но для создания роботов Вам нужно примерно знать всего несколько. Ну а сами папки, по сути, можно называть «Пространства имён», которые Вы должны научиться использовать. Про это сегодня и поговорим.

Пространства имен — это способ группировки кода, который позволяет организовать логическую и удобную структуру проекта. Как правило, типы, связанные общей идеей и схожей функциональностью, содержатся в общем пространстве.
Во время разработки торговых роботов в OsEngine нужно примерно представлять откуда и что берётся. Где хранятся те или иные сущности в проекте. Рассмотрим базовые пространства, которые Вам точно пригодятся.
Начнём с того, что посмотрим, что такое пространство имён в исходном коде на примере почти любого робота, доступного в платформе. В файле с кодом пространство задается при помощи ключевого слова namespace:
Компании из ВПК, может банки? Нет, всего 4 компаний (Microsoft, Google, Amazon и Meta), если говорить о «цифровом мире».
Весьма показателен недавний инцидент с прерыванием критической ИТ инфраструктуры, вызванный обновлением от компании CrowdStrike, которое затронуло множество IT-систем по всему миру.
Сбой был вызван дефектным обновлением программного обеспечения, выпущенным CrowdStrike, компанией, специализирующейся на кибербезопасности. Обновление содержало ошибку в логике, которая привела к сбоям в работе компьютеров под управлением Windows (примерно 8.5 млн устройств), вызывая синий экран смерти (BSOD).
Пострадали авиакомпании, банки, СМИ и многие другие критические сектора.
Так причем здесь ТОП-4? Сейчас почти любой софт, любая ИТ система, имеющая выход в сеть, замыкается на экосистему ТОП-4.
Что такое экосистема? Вычислительные мощности + средства хранения данных + базы данных + сеть + ИИ и машинное обучение + инструменты разработки приложений.
Microsoft Azure:
• Вычисления: Виртуальные машины (VMs), контейнеры, Kubernetes, функции без сервера (Azure Functions).
Для программирования (не для запуска, а именно для разработки) торговых роботов в OsEngine вам понадобится среда разработки. Иначе они называются IDE. Это нужно для того, чтобы не писать исходный код в текстовых файлах, а делать это с комфортом и быстро.
Существует несколько программ, подходящих для этих целей. К таковым относятся Visual Studio, Rider, Visual Studio Code и другие, менее известные варианты.
Каждый выбирает то, что ему больше нравится, но, если вы затрудняетесь в выборе, мы настоятельно рекомендуем остановиться на Visual Studio Community. И в этом посте мы поговорим о том, как её установить. Программа полностью бесплатная, как и наш OsEngine.

Выбор Visual Studio будет идеальным вариантом, который закроет все ваши потребности.
Visual Studio имеет в своем арсенале как стандартные инструменты (редактор, отладчик), так и массу приятных дополнительных функций (компиляторы, оптимизаторы кода, графические конструкторы и др.), которые делают процесс разработки более продуктивным, интересным и качественным.
В этой статье поговорим о компоненте «Antimalware Service Executable», который является частью антивирусника Windows и приносит больше вреда, чем пользы, поскольку съедает очень много всех видов памяти.
Нехватка памяти – извечная проблема всех активных компьютерных пользователей. И, конечно же, в алготрейдинге этот вопрос очень актуален, поэтому мы поделимся с вами очень хорошим способом снижения нагрузки на ЦП.
Деактивировать вредоносный компонент будем при помощи редактора политики «gpedit»:
Изменения, баг-фикс и улучшения, которые были внесены в проект за предыдущий месяц.
1. Журнал. График эквити. Добавлен зум и дополнительные подписи для сделок. Не закрытые сделки отображаются фиолетовым:
Обновляемый сборник статей, касающийся различных подходов к алгоритмической торговле и программирования роботов на Os Engine. Всё в одном месте. Сборник сборников.
1. Скринеры акций. Стартовый набор роботов.
1. Системные требования. Текст. Видео.
2. Знакомство с Os Engine. Скачивание и Запуск терминала. Текст. Видео.
3. Зачем нужны спец-терминалы для алготрейдинга? Текст. Видео.
4. Сервер приёма крашей в OsEngine. Текст. Видео.
5. Поддержка OsEngine по направлению MOEX. Текст. Видео.
6. Поддержка OsEngine по направлению крипты.
7. Поддержка OsEngine по направлению международной торговли.
8. Почему Os Engine написан на С# (си шарп) Текст. Видео.
9. Профконнекторы для MOEX. Сертификаты.
10. Обновление движка для OsEngine. Переехали на .NET 9 Текст. Видео.
1. Главное меню. Текст. Видео.
2. Os Data 2.0. Текст. Видео.